When you perfectly match skills to challenge...you achieve 'flow' - you get so engrossed in what you are doing, you 'lose' yourself in the game. Intrinsic motivation. Perfect balance of challenge and skills = flow.

Gamification?

This idea is not exclusive to education. It was one of Core Education's top ten trends for 2014.

eg Domino stars, loyalty cards, Fly Buys

Building a game layer on top of the world.

How do you encourage people to take the stairs?


Serious games - games specifically designed for a particular reason.

SPARX from Uni of Auckland and the Min of Health
Quest2Teach for teacher training.
